One key factor behind the success of Morgan Stanley Bitcoin Trust is its aggressive pricing strategy. With a fee of just 0.14%, it undercuts several competitors, making it one of the most cost-efficient options for investors seeking Bitcoin exposure.</p>
<p dir="auto">The ETF market is becoming increasingly competitive, with major players like Goldman Sachs also moving into the space. Meanwhile, giants like BlackRock continue to dominate, with their Bitcoin ETF leading in total inflows by a significant margin.</p>
<p dir="auto">As more institutions enter the market, fee competition and brand trust are becoming critical factors in attracting capital, signaling a maturing phase for crypto investment products.</p>
